Wiles Mensch Corporation – DC (WMC-DC) provided surveying and civil engineering services for the demolition of an existing office building, and the construction of a 15-story residential building located at 2000 Clarendon Boulevard in Arlington, Virginia.
The WM survey team provided utility and topographic surveys as a basis for the design team, as well as subdivision services. Preliminary and final plat and condominium plans were also provided. Civil services ranged from schematic design to construction administration and include site grading, traffic control plans, and photometric street lighting plans.
The development will include 90 residential condominium units, with a percentage of those units designated as affordable housing. 2,000 SF of ground floor retail, 112 underground parking spaces, a rooftop club room with kitchen, and event space are planned for the project. A two-level cascading pool and sun deck is also be featured as an attracting amenity.
The project was designed to achieve LEED Silver certification.
